Not only was the area ranked the #1 place to live in the 2007 edition of Cities Ranked and Rated, but it was also called one of the “best places to live and play” in 2007 by National Geographic Adventure.When we say there’s a little something for everyone in our city, we mean it.Jan 4, 2023 · Possibly one of the most unique things to do in Gainesville is to visit Devil’s Millhopper. This is one of the only Florida spots where a sink hole has more than 100 feet of exposed rock layers. You walk down 120 feet into the cavity and see the rainforest-esque views of the sink hole. Visiting Marjorie Kinnan Rawlings Historic State Park. Majorie Kinnan Rawlings’s Florida Cracker-style home and farm in Cross Creek is where she lived. It’s also where she wrote the Pulitzer Prize-winning novel The Yearling. It is now part of the Florida State Park system and is open to the public. Explore the local farm-to-fork …According to the United States Census Bureau as of July 2022, an estimated 145,214 people call the city of Gainesville Florida home. This is a 2.9% increase from the April 2020 census when the population was 141,085. Bike, hike, or walk the scenic 16 miles of the Gainesville-Hawthorne State Trail, a historic railway-turned-greenway. The trail travels through several local and state conservation lands including Boulware Springs Park and Paynes Prairie Preserve State Park. floridastateparks.org, 3400 S.E. 15th St, Gainesville FL 32641.Mar 24, 2021 · 1. The prank involves sticking dozens or eve...Apr 19, 2023 · Lake Alice. Not just a beautiful lake, Lake Alice is among the top places to see in Gainesville for nature lovers. The lake, located on the University of Florida campus, teems with wildlife, including alligators and softback turtles. The best way to experience Lake Alice is to saunter along the boardwalk, dipping into the woods and swampland. The Butterfly Rainforest is a 6,400-square-foot screened exhibit exposed to typical Florida weather conditions, resulting in a more natural environment for the butterflies and plants. This living exhibit features hundreds of free-flying butterflies, typically more than 50 species at any given time, birds from around the world and an assortment ... See what other travellers like to do, based on ratings and number of bookings. Tours & Sightseeing (6) …3. Visit the Florida Museum of Natural History. This wonderful museum is situated on Hull Road, off SW 34 th Street in Gainesville. There is parking nearby. At the museum you will find the Butterfly Rainforest, a four-story, outdoor screened enclosure with waterfalls, tropical plants, a walking trail and hundreds of live butterflies.
